structure WIM_PROVIDER_ADD_OVERLAY_INPUT (ntifs.h)
La structure WIM_PROVIDER_ADD_OVERLAY_INPUT permet d’ajouter une nouvelle source de données WiM (Windows Image File) au fournisseur WIM.
Syntaxe
typedef struct _WIM_PROVIDER_ADD_OVERLAY_INPUT {
ULONG WimType;
ULONG WimIndex;
ULONG WimFileNameOffset;
ULONG WimFileNameLength;
} WIM_PROVIDER_ADD_OVERLAY_INPUT, *PWIM_PROVIDER_ADD_OVERLAY_INPUT;
Membres
WimType
Type de fichier WIM défini en tant que source de stockage. Le type de fichier WIM est défini sur l’une des valeurs suivantes.
Valeur | Signification |
---|---|
WIM_BOOT_OS_WIM | Le fichier WIM contient des fichiers système Windows. |
WIM_BOOT_NOT_OS_WIM | Le fichier WIM contient des fichiers de système non d’exploitation. |
WimIndex
Index de l’image dans le fichier WIM dont le nom de fichier est spécifié dans WimFileNameOffset.
WimFileNameOffset
Décalage, en octets, à partir du début de cette structure du nom de fichier pour le fichier WIM à ajouter en tant que source de stockage. Le nom de fichier est une chaîne de valeurs de caractères WCHAR .
WimFileNameLength
Longueur, en octets, du nom de fichier trouvé dans WimFileNameOffset.
Remarques
Le nom de fichier WIM est inclus immédiatement après WIM_PROVIDER_ADD_OVERLAY_INPUT dans la mémoire tampon système pour une demande de contrôle FSCTL_ADD_OVERLAY . Le membre WimFileNameOffset a la valeur sizeof(WIM_PROVIDER_ADD_OVERLAY_INPUT).
Le nom de fichier WIM inclut un caractère NULL de fin. WimFileNameLength contient la longueur du nom de fichier, à l’exclusion de la valeur NULL de fin.
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Mise à jour Windows 8.1 |
En-tête | ntifs.h (include Ntifs.h, Fltkernel.h) |